    "I should be fit as a fiddle - I love mountain biking and hiking but studying for a couple of degrees alongside a full time job doesn't leave any time to do either. So I find myself reaching 32 years old, overweight, under-fit and tearful at the mental torment both bring. So I'm going to run. Nothing new, nothing unusual, I'm just another girl who's sick of the sedentary life. Join me as I drag myself off the sofa and jog my way towards the starting line of the Great North Run in September 2012."
